7.2 Solving Systems of Equations Algebraically 1 Solve by Substitution 2 Examples 3 Practice Problems

Definitions System of Equations Consistent System Inconsistent System 2 or more equations on the same coordinate system Consistent System Graph of equations cross each other (not parallel) System has a solution Slope is different Inconsistent System Graph of equations do not cross each other (parallel) System does not have a solution Slope is the same

Consistent System Has a solution at (1,2) (1,2)

Inconsistent System No Solution

Solve by Substitution Steps Solve for x in the first equation Substitute the answer in for x in the second equation Solve for y Substitute the value of y into either of the original equations Solve for x Take the value of x and y and put them in ordered pair form (x,y)
